Florence's game on Friday was all tied up 2-2 at the half, but sadly for them it didn't stay that way. They came up short against the St. Mary's Pirates, falling 8-3. Kaydence Martinez probably wasn't too happy after the matchup: she scored every single goal for Florence and still walked away on the losing team.
Florence is on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 3-5. As for St. Mary's, their victory was their first in the league, bumping their league record up to 1-2 and their overall record up to 3-3-1.
Coming up, Florence will welcome Ellicott at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for St. Mary's, they will head out to face off against Front Range Christian at 10:00 a.m. on Saturday.
